I recently purchased the edger for my stihl 94 kombi system. I have noticed that the drive shaft inside the tube can be moved up and down unlike the drive shafts I have in any of the other tubes I have e.g. the hedge trimmer. This is causing the shaft to slip out of the edger at times when it is in use. Does anyone know how to fix this problem so that the shaft is immovable inside the tube?
